How do you change the battery in a Samsung Smart Tag 2? I think this works for the smart tags as well. What we need is either a pin or a needle or a push pin or best of all is a phone sim ejector tool. This is a gift to future me. I managed to keep this in an envelope. The SmartTag 2 is designed to be water resistant and also child resistance as well. So, they've hidden the eject button. I was looking on the side, couldn't find it. You will never believe where it is. Let me catch the sun at the right angle. There's the ejector hole. And what I'm going to do is use my SIM ejector tool. My phone tray ejector tool. I'm just going to push that down. Oh, I had to really push hard for that. I don't know whether mine is just sealed up over time or if it's designed to be really tough, but you have to really push it hard. And now we can pull out the battery tray.
Oh, right. So, don't forget it's that side up. And if I flip it over, you can see that that's the negative side. You need the positive side, which is usually where the details of the battery are. And the positive side sits on top of this notch here. So, that's the way up that you want the battery to be. And it's a CR2032. Again, it's another gift to future me. I managed to buy some in the past. You can get these from supermarkets in the UK. I'll show you in a moment what we need to do with the app. But to put the battery into the tray, it just sits on it like that. So the notch is open to the positive side. And then to put this in, I think this can only go in one way. So I'll try and do it the wrong way. That won't go in. So it has to be this way round. So, the positive side goes to the back of the Samsung SmartTag2. You can see there's like a black notch there. And I'll just push it in until it clicks. There. So, that's back in. Oh, it just beeped. I didn't touch it. It just beeps. I've just put the battery in. I've got the Samsung Smart Things app up on screen now. And you can see the battery is sufficient. Nice big green battery logo there. But, will it work? Let me press play on the ringtone to see if Oh, it can find it. So, it it hasn't lost or forgotten the tag, which is great. But if it doesn't find it instantly, I'll put Samsung's instructions on screen now. Congratulations. You have changed the battery in your Samsung Galaxy SmartTag 2. I'm calling this delivers success.
